About K-BOB Korean Street Food
Started by a 19 year old local graduate! K-BOB is Orlando's first Doodle Restaurant serving: Cupbob, Boba, Korean Corndogs and Hotteok's. On April 13, co-owner Giovanni Harris wrote What Now Orlando, articulating his inspiration and vision for the... More
